About this clipart
This playful illustration features an anthropomorphic sun with expressive eyes and a grin, holding a classic analog clock showing 2:00, symbolizing the moment clocks are adjusted. The bold text “DAYLIGHT SAVINGS TIME” reinforces the theme in a friendly, educational tone ideal for public awareness campaigns. The image is designed to make a potentially confusing seasonal change feel approachable and memorable.
Used on government, utility, or educational websites during March (spring forward) and November (fall back) to inform the public about DST transitions; matches user intent to understand timing, rules, or reminders for clock changes.
